This is a set of parts to Yoon Jae Lee's transcription for full orchestra of Mendelssohn's Overture for Winds in C Major, Op. 24. The full score is available separately.
Originally conceived as a work titled "Nocturno" for an 11-piece Harmonie in 1824, Mendelssohn revised the work for a full 24-piece wind ensemble in 1838. In a letter to his publisher Simrock, Mendelssohn mentions a version for strings but nothing more is known about whether or not Mendelssohn ever made that version. This 2016 transcription for full orchestra by conductor & arranger Yoon Jae Lee now makes this exuberant overture accessible to orchestras worldwide. The trombone parts are ad lib.
